Weinstein acquires Stephen Frears's 'Philomena' with Judi Dench for Fall 2013 release

Posted by · 9:46 am · May 23rd, 2013

The Weinstein Company came to Cannes ready to show off with films like “Only God Forgives” (via VOD shingle RADiUS) and “Fruitvale Station” in tow, not to mention a big presentation of material from biopics “Grace of Monaco” and “Mandela: Long Walk to Freedom.” There were rumblings that footage from Judi Dench starrer “Philomena” at the film market had revved the distributors engines, and indeed, today TWC has announced acquisition of the title in the US, UK and Spain and positioned it in the fall of 2013, obviously aiming for an awards trajectory.

Todd Haynes teams with Cate Blanchett and Mia Wasikowska for 'Carol'

Posted by · 11:36 am · May 22nd, 2013

When last we heard from Todd Haynes (save a quick trip to HBO’s “Enlightened”), he had brought James M. Cain’s “Mildred Pierce” to the small screen via mini-series. Kate Winslet stormed the awards circuit winning every trophy in sight (much like Michael Douglas seems poised to do this year for “Behind the Candelabra”) and the event was in general a nice fit in Haynes’s oeuvre of female-centric drama. He’s set for another as he transitions back to the big screen with “Carol,” Screen Daily reports.

'Crouching Tiger' sequel to be directed by 'The Matrix' and 'Kill Bill' choreographer Yuen Wo Ping

Posted by · 12:47 pm · May 16th, 2013

The Weinstein Company has announced today that production on “Crouching Tiger, Hidden Dragon II: The Green Destiny” will begin in March of 2014 in Asia. Yuen Wo Ping is set to direct after serving as a choreographer on the original film, which was directed by Ang Lee was nominated for 10 Academy Awards, winning four.
